Get in Touch** The BMW repair market for Newburg residents is characterized by a reliance on shops in the larger neighboring towns of Waldorf and La Plata. There is a clear tiered structure in service providers: * **Top-Tier Specialists:** Shops like Rennhaus and Autobahn Automotive represent the premium, dedicated BMW/European service tier. They command higher labor rates ($150-$190/hr) justified by their specialized tools, ongoing technician training, and direct experience with common and complex BMW issues. They are the go-to for xDrive, advanced engine work, and electrical diagnostics. * **High-Quality Generalists:** Providers like K&M offer a strong alternative for routine servicing and non-specialized repairs, often at a more competitive labor rate ($120-$150/hr). This provides a valuable option for owners of older BMWs or those seeking cost-effective maintenance without sacrificing quality. Competition is healthy but not saturated, ensuring that reputable shops maintain high standards to retain their customer base. The absence of a local BMW dealership in the immediate area means these independent shops are the primary resource for owners, fostering an environment where expertise and customer service are paramount for success. Overall, a Newburg BMW owner has access to competent, specialized care without needing to travel to Washington D.C. or Baltimore.

Due to our local climate and rural roads, common issues include premature brake wear from stop-and-go traffic on Route 301, cooling system failures exacerbated by summer heat, and suspension component wear from potholes and uneven country lanes. Electrical issues related to battery drain and sensor faults are also frequent across many BMW models.
Look for shops in Charles County that are specifically "BMW Certified" or have technicians with advanced BMW training (ASE Master Technicians). Check reviews for shops in nearby La Plata or Waldorf that highlight expertise with German vehicles, and verify they use OEM or high-quality aftermarket parts compatible with your model's systems.
Labor rates in Newburg and surrounding Charles County are typically lower than in Washington D.C. or Baltimore suburbs, but the cost for genuine BMW parts remains consistent. The overall bill is often less, but specialized repairs still require premium parts and expertise, making preventative maintenance crucial to avoid major expenses.
Seek immediate diagnostics if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ter—common on older BMWs. For a steady light, schedule a scan at a local shop with BMW-specific diagnostic tools to address issues like oxygen sensor failures or fuel system faults before they worsen, especially before long drives on sparse local highways.
The proximity to the Potomac River and Chesapeake Bay increases humidity and road salt exposure, accelerating corrosion on undercarriage components. Schedule more frequent undercarriage washes and inspections. Also, consider that longer distances to specialized parts suppliers can mean slightly longer repair times, so plan service appointments ahead of peak seasonal driving.
